I’m sure this one isn’t as hard as I think, but I’d really like your help getting my tachometer to work.
So, I have a 2LT in the place of a 22RE. I’m using the Gas Dash Cluster which is my first problem. But here’s where I’m at:
I had so signal wire. I assume it must have been on the bell housing at one point on whatever truck the 2LT came from. No W terminal, no wire off injection pump. However,
I had my local alternator shop open my Alternator and add me a W terminal, so now I have a source.
Long story short,
1.) I ran a wire from my now “W terminal” inside the truck. 2.) Purchased the Dakota SGI-100BT to convert the Diesel signal 3.) Ran Power and Ground to the SGI, also attached to “Signal Wire” to the input of the Dakota box. 4.) Coming out of the SGI-100BT I have the converted signal wire.. But do not know where to splice it in.
I’ve google searched and seen people hooking it up to the “P” post on the back of the cluster. I’ve read to tap into the “Black or Green Wire” on the back of the Blue Connector..
I’m really unsure. And don’t mind doing a trial and error process but I can’t seem to get any motion from my tach yet. Mind you, I only tried the posts on the back. Do I need to tap into the Blue Connector for this?
I also seen people taking the cluster apart and soldering in resistors.. not knowing where to go from here. I figured I would try to post here and hopefully get a simplified answer since I’m so close to the end.
